Output 52aed36d3e6f98e9c5bd7be6fdfe6a9c70f2adc32872bd3ca6e143232aba1099:0

value
30474652
script pubkey
OP_0 OP_PUSHBYTES_20 dc12881f2e28e918ce9f58e6c781dea8fd50dc6b
address
tb1qmsfgs8ew9r533n5ltrnv0qw74r74phrt8a0j86
transaction
52aed36d3e6f98e9c5bd7be6fdfe6a9c70f2adc32872bd3ca6e143232aba1099